Bunny Meadow Veggie Board (Print Version)

Spring veggie platter shaped like a bunny with fresh vegetables and dip.

# Components:

→ Vegetables

01 - 1 cup baby carrots
02 - 1 cup sugar snap peas
03 - 1 cup mixed color cherry tomatoes
04 - 1 cup broccoli florets
05 - 1 cup cauliflower florets
06 - 1 cup cucumber slices
07 - ½ cup thinly sliced radishes
08 - 1 yellow bell pepper, sliced
09 - 1 red bell pepper, sliced
10 - ¼ cup black olives
11 - ¼ cup green onions or chives

→ Dip

12 - 1 cup hummus or ranch dip

→ Garnishes

13 - Fresh dill or parsley sprigs
14 - Edible flowers (optional)

# Directions:

01 - Place a small bowl filled with hummus or ranch dip at the center of a large platter to serve as the bunny's body.
02 - Create the bunny's head above the dip by shaping a mound of cauliflower florets.
03 - Form bunny ears using rows of cucumber slices outlined by carrot sticks.
04 - Use black olives to represent the bunny's eyes and nose; optionally, place a cherry tomato as the nose.
05 - Arrange radish slices for cheeks and add small strips of bell pepper to simulate whiskers.
06 - Surround the bunny arrangement with broccoli, snap peas, cherry tomatoes, and bell pepper slices to simulate a vibrant meadow.
07 - Insert green onions or chives to mimic grass blades and tuck in fresh dill or parsley sprigs for a meadow effect.
08 - Scatter edible flowers over the arrangement for an optional festive touch.
09 - Serve immediately with extra dip offered on the side.

# Expert Advice:

01 -
  • Perfect for parties or Easter gatherings
  • Healthy vegetarian and gluten-free snack
02 -
  • For vegan boards ensure the dip is plant-based
  • Swap vegetables based on seasonality or preference try asparagus tips celery or blanched green beans
03 -
  • Use a variety of colors to make the board visually appealing
  • Keep veggies fresh by preparing just before serving
